First you make two giant cookies on a baking sheet, which goes against everything your mom taught you about cookie making because the middle won’t bake and blah-de-blah, but they come out fine. Then bake and when you slice them up the insides are soft and the outsides are crisp and it’s the way a cookie was meant to be…even if they don’t look like your typical cookie.
